| Giving Hope to the Poor in Mexico |
|
Puerto Penasco, Mexico is a popular destination just
four hours south of Phoenix, Arizona. Not far from the beaches and
restaurants of Puerto Penasco lay an impoverished community called
Colonia Oriente. God laid a heavy burden for these people on the
hearts of Juaro and Rose Silva. It was easy to identify all of the
suffering and hardships caused by a lack of basic necessities such
as shelter, electricity, food and water, however the Silvas also say
a great spiritual need as well. Thus the Association for
International Ministries (AIM) was formed. |

Our Mission
We are a
Christ-centered organization committed to reaching out to
impoverished communities in Sonora,
Mexico. AIM addresses the physical and social needs of the
community through non-perishable food distribution,
education and preventative health programs. Spiritual
needs are met through evangelistic programs in conjunction
with local church organizations.
Our Vision
We desire to see
the people we serve become Christ-centered,
self-sufficient and able to
reach out and serve others
intheir own community.
